Doing Business in Canada: for Alaska companiesTrade experts say partnering with firms across border will pave way for smooth Alaska-Canada operations Steve Sutherlin PNA Managing Editor
The U.S.-Canada border is not a barrier to Alaska companies hoping to grab a slice of the multi-billion dollar contracts which would flow from any decision to build natural gas pipelines from the North Slope or Canada’s Mackenzie Delta.
